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Develop contribution guide #4

Open
bilsch opened this issue Oct 28, 2018 · 5 comments
Open

Develop contribution guide #4

bilsch opened this issue Oct 28, 2018 · 5 comments

Comments

@bilsch
Copy link
Contributor

bilsch commented Oct 28, 2018

We will need to develop some kind of guide which will give clear instructions for how to go about contributing to the source code, documentation etc.

I think the github setting guidelines for repository contributors docs cover this pretty well. We would want to implement this to a standard github project as a template.

We will want to come up with at a minimum the CONTRIBUTIONS.md for the repositories to all use. The guidelines doc mentioned previously has links to a few examples.

We should likely also have standards for pull request templates

@bilsch
Copy link
Contributor Author

bilsch commented Oct 28, 2018

One thing we may want to consider here is to have participants contribute a PR for a CONTRIBUTORS.md file in the main repo and then include that somehow in the wiki - thoughts?

@tchellis
Copy link
Collaborator

Is there a cliff notes version that relates to how the TWG can use it simplify our collaboration?

@bilsch
Copy link
Contributor Author

bilsch commented Oct 29, 2018

re-posting a side conversation with @tchellis

The ask here, as I have parsed it, is to develop some kind of statement with how we intend to function within the context of using github issues and wiki along with whatever resultant documents / procedures would come of these efforts.

The request was less to do specifically with the contributors.md document creation itself and more how the workflow fundamentally works. I recommend we discuss this as part of the call 10/31 and let the group decide these questions to some degree.

My opinion which was shared is along the lines of the wiki being more of a document index with topics pointing around to the work and/or the github issues which is where the discussion / work would happen. The output of the issue would be to create some kind of document which is then a part of the wiki content itself.

@rubberduck203
Copy link
Contributor

I feel like developing a CONTRIBUTING.md is premature and possibly out of scope for this group. The contents of that file will vary repository by repository and the people best suited for writing those will be the core dev team.

I do think it’s in scope for us to recommend that they get created though.

@bilsch
Copy link
Contributor Author

bilsch commented Dec 7, 2018

There has been some discussion in #14 about developing a contribution guide being somewhat out of scope for the twg. Recommending that one be created is within scope.

I do agree with this assertion so for now this issue will be detached from the milestone. We can re-visit this later.

@bilsch bilsch removed this from the December 13 deliverables milestone Dec 7, 2018
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ants